Dan at ERD is literally the only person I'd let touch my car. He's like the Yoda of car's, if yoda and chewie had a lovechild. Rare thing about him too is his honesty. For example my spigot was rooted so I organised to get a new clutch in. I get a phone call from Dan an hr after dropping it off telling me that the clutch in there atm is basically new and presented me with the options to keep the one in there and replace what's needed or continue on with the replacement. I went ahead with the npc street anyways cos I'm wanting big power down the line, but say if I wasn't, I could have saved $400 odd dollars.     • Put the ECU's MAP line in your mouth. Blow as hard as you can. You should be able to see about 10 kPa, maybe 15 kPa positive pressure. Suck on it. You should be able to generate a decent vacuum to about the same level also. Note that this is only ~2 psi either way. If the MAP is reading -5 psi all the time, ignition on, engine running or not, driving around or not, then it is severely f**ked. Also, you SHOULD NOT BE DRIVING IT WITHOUT A LOAD REFERENCE. You will break the engine. Badly.
